Search for vector-like quarks in the single lepton final state using deep neural networks
POSTER
Abstract
Vector-like quarks are massive fermionic top quark partners featured in several new physics models. We present a search by the CMS experiment for vector-like T and B quarks in the single lepton final state using all data collected in Run 2. This search improves on previous CMS searches by using deep neural network jet identification and a custom deep network for signal discrimination, providing expanded sensitivity to high mass T and B quarks.
